Groovy Season Font for Printable Wall Art and Digital Downloads
For printable creators, a font is the soul of the design. Groovy Season excels as a display font for digital products like wall art and downloadable quotes. Its inherently fun personality makes it perfect for phrases like “Peace & Love” or “Stay Golden.” When creating a printable art piece, I treat the typography as the main visual element. Using Groovy Season for the headline and pairing it with a clean, minimalist sans-serif for any subtext creates a balanced, eye-catching composition that feels both retro and modern. This approach ensures the printable is instantly recognizable as a premium digital download, with the retro font adding significant perceived value and emotional appeal.
Using Groovy Season for Wedding Invitations and Elegant Branding
You might think a retro, disco-era font is too bold for wedding stationery, but that’s where its magic lies. Groovy Season can bring a unique, elegant flair to themed weddings. For a “Love is Eternal” welcome sign or a “Mr. & Mrs.” header on invitations, this groovy typeface offers a stunning decorative option. I use it sparingly, for the key names and titles only, letting its bold curves be the focal point. It pairs beautifully with a delicate script font for the body text, creating a stationery suite that is cohesive, memorable, and utterly charming. The font’s display nature means it’s ideal for short, impactful wording, ensuring readability even when printed on large format boards or intricate card stock.

Groovy Season Display Font for Holiday Cards and Seasonal Crafts
Crafting seasonal items requires a font that can carry a mood. Groovy Season effortlessly captures the celebratory spirit needed for holiday greeting cards, Halloween party invites, or New Year’s printable planners. Its fun essence is perfect for phrases like “Happy Holidays” or “Spooky Season.” When designing a card mockup, I use the font for the main greeting and then switch to a simpler typeface for the message inside. This keeps the design clean and legible while letting the retro font shine on the cover. For Cricut or Silhouette projects, like cut vinyl for mugs or tote bags, the solid, well-defined shapes of this groovy typeface cut cleanly, resulting in a professional-looking finished product.

Before committing any font to commercial use, it’s crucial to check the licensing details. As a seller of physical products and digital downloads, I ensure that Groovy Season comes with a proper commercial license that covers my intended use—selling candles with the font on labels, or offering printables with the font embedded. I also explore the included file formats to ensure compatibility with my design software and cutting machines, and look for any special features like alternates or ligatures that can add extra customization to my designs. This due diligence turns a creative font into a reliable, professional design asset.
Groovy Season for Mug Designs and Merchandise Mockups
Applying typography to physical merchandise like mugs or t-shirts requires careful consideration of scale and material. Groovy Season, as a bold display font, is excellent for this application. When creating a mockup for a “Morning Coffee” mug, the font’s curves and wide strokes create a design that wraps pleasingly around the cylinder. For a tote bag, a phrase like “Good Vibes” rendered in this groovy typeface becomes a walking statement piece. In mockup images for my shop listings, the font helps the product stand out, suggesting a premium, thoughtfully designed item. The key is to keep the wording short and impactful, allowing the retro font’s personality to be the hero of the design without overcrowding the product surface.
